Birmingham police in Alabama are searching for a 21-year-old woman who hasn’t been seen in over two weeks.
According to the Birmingham Police Department, Sharon Renee Woods was last seen on March 15 while walking in the vicinity of Avondale Park in the Avondale area. Police said that Woods has a diagnosed medical condition impacting her behavior and judgment.
She’s described as a Black female who stands 5 feet, 2 inches tall and weighs 107 pounds, She was last seen wearing a black skull cap.
